Filing a Mesothelioma Asbestos Claim

The filing of a mesothelioma asbestos claim could offer victims compensation for their illness. Compensation can be used to pay for medical treatment.

Many companies that produce asbestos were aware of the dangers it poses but did not warn their employees or customers. The negligent companies should be held accountable.

Statute of Limitations

The statute of limitations can be complicated by the fact that as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ma take years to manifest. An experienced lawyer can help victims in determining their deadlines, and then filing within the timeframes. The lawyer will go over the claim, inform defendants, and build the case using evidence and either settle the case or argue for a jury award at trial.

The statute of limitations for states that are specific to personal injury and wrongful death cases are different. Numerous factors influence the way that the statute of limitations is applied, including the time when asbestos exposure occurred, the location where the victim lives, which states they worked in, and the location of asbestos companies.

The rule of discovery is beneficial to most asbestos victims. It allows the statute of limitations to begin when the disease was discovered, or at the time it would be reasonable to be discovered. This differs from states' statutory periods that are usually established to begin with the date of the first exposure.

The statute of limitations could be tolled, or paused in certain circumstances, like when the victim is a minor or lacked the legal capacity to file. It is also possible that the statute of limitations may be extended in certain cases such as cases of fraud or concealment.

If the statute of limitations expires before the mesothelioma suit is filed, the mesothelioma victims may lose their chance to be compensated. However, they might have other options for financial compensation, like trust funds or insurance.

Anyone who is eligible for an asbestos fund could be eligible for compensation in addition to any court ruling. Each trust sets its own deadline for filing a claim. Asbestos Trust Funds

Trust funds are available to asbestos victims who suffer from ailments like m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ases. These trust funds were created by companies that manufactured or sold asbestos-containing products and went bankrupt. These compan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to set aside funds in trusts to pay the victims of asbestos-containing products.

Each asbestos trust has its own requirements for eligibility that must be met for victims to receive financial compensation. A mesothelioma attorney can assist victims to understand these criteria and gather documents they need to make claims. This includes proofs of employment, military service records and medical records proving that the victim was diagnosed having an asbestos-related disease.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ist patients in filing for expedited reviews at each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ed quicker and may increase the amount of compensation a victim is awarded. There is a limit to the amount an individual can receive after an expedited review.

The asbestos trust fund is able to offer compensation of up to six figures for victims suffering from asbestos-related diseases. This compensation is meant to pay for a variety of expenses like mesothelioma treatments, funeral costs, lost income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of a cash settlement or an award from a jury. The amount of compensation a claim can receive is contingent on the type and severity of asbestos-related illness and the extent to which the victim's quality of life has been impacted, the amount of lost wages, and medical expenses. A mesothelioma attorney will examine your situation and explain to you the options available to compensation.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led without court. Most mesothelioma cases are settled outside of court.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ma cases are able to pinpoint possible sources of compensation quickly. They will often review decades-old records of purchase orders, find witnesses and review other records to determine the asbestos exposure at a particular area.

The companies that extracted and produced asbestos and who made and used asbestos-containing products, should compensate the victims of mesothelioma. The victims are typically exposed workers who were deprived of their rights by defendants who placed them in the vicinity of this carcinogen.

In many states, those diagnosed mesothelioma can have the right to sue companies who caused the damage. Those lawsuits are known as personal injury or mesothelioma lawsuits.

Asbestos cases can be complicated and require an extensive legal investigation. A skilled mesothelioma attorney has the expertise to gather evidence to file a lawsuit, and go to trial if necessary.

Individuals who are di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ness or their loved ones can also pursue workers compensation claims. These could cover medical expenses and loss of income. These claims are usually filed with the state's workers compensation office. It is also important to consider whether they qualify for government-run insurance programs like Medicare and Medicaid, which provide healthcare coverage for seniors as well as individuals with low household incomes.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while in the military can apply for ben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). VA benefits can pay for treatment in some of the most prestigious mesothelioma treatment centers around the world, and a monthly disability payment based on the severity of an illness or injury caused by service. These benefits do not interfere with the filing of an injury lawsuit or VA disability compensation claim. However veterans must file both to get the maximum compensation.
